Engine Pre‑Heater Coolant Hose Assembly

This direct‑fit molded coolant hose feeds the pre‑heater circuit on Subaru boxer engines. It keeps warm coolant flowing during cold starts for faster warm‑up, smooth idle, and quick cabin heat. Built from heat‑resistant EPDM with kink‑free bends, it’s designed for stable flow and long life. OEM ref: 21204AB230.

Why you need it ❄️

On cold mornings, the pre‑heater loop warms the intake area and assists defrost. This hose is the link that carries coolant through that loop. A healthy hose protects against icing, reduces emissions at start‑up, and improves driver comfort.

How it works

The hose connects the bypass side of the cooling system to the pre‑heater passages. Even when the thermostat is closed, coolant circulates through this line, stabilizing temperatures. Molded angles prevent collapse, while OE‑style spring clamps maintain sealing under pressure and vibration.

What happens if it fails ⚠️

Cracks, swelling, or soft spots lead to leaks, sweet coolant smell, and low level. Expect poor cabin heat, rough cold starts, and potential overheating. Air pockets may trigger hot spots and, in severe cases, head gasket damage. Coolant on belts can cause squeal and premature wear.

Install tips ✅

Work on a cold engine, relieve pressure, drain a little coolant, and replace both clamps. Lightly lubricate fittings, seat the hose fully, and bleed the system after refill. Use Subaru‑approved coolant and recheck for seepage after a short drive.
